People Score in 01039, Haydenville, Massachusetts

The People Score for the Alzheimers Score in 01039, Haydenville, Massachusetts is 87 when comparing 34,000 ZIP Codes in the United States.

An estimate of 99.16 percent of the residents in 01039 has some form of health insurance. 38.27 percent of the residents have some type of public health insurance like Medicare, Medicaid, Veterans Affairs (VA), or TRICARE. About 75.88 percent of the residents have private health insurance, either through their employer or direct purchase.

A resident in 01039 would have to travel an average of 3.86 miles to reach the nearest hospital with an emergency room, Cooley Dickinson Hospital Inc,The. In a 20-mile radius, there are 2,233 healthcare providers accessible to residents living in 01039, Haydenville, Massachusetts.
